Onboarding note — Tokenflip refresh bug

Welcome aboard. Known issue: the Nimbrel gateway drops session tokens mid-refresh under load, logging users out randomly. Workaround lives in the hotfix branch; don't merge without Petra's review. To reproduce locally you need the staging auth vault, which unlocks with the recovery passphrase below.

strongbox words: briiel-zoreth-noveth-pelys-druwyn-feniel-lamvan-ulaius-kasion

## Driftpane Environments

Driftpane, our diff viewer for large files, runs in three environments: sandbox, staging, and production. Sandbox uses synthetic repositories and relaxed size limits, which is why a diff that renders there may time out in production. Reviewers should verify chunked-rendering behavior in staging, where limits match production exactly. Production streams hunks lazily above the size threshold. Each environment overrides the base settings; staging currently uses the following values.

service settings:
PRAIX_LOG_LEVEL=error
PRAIX_METRICS_HOST=metrics.praix.qorvelcorp.corp
PRAIX_POOL_SIZE=16

**Q: Why do tax rates sometimes look stale after a jurisdiction update?**

The Quillbarrow rate cache refreshes on a 6-hour cycle, so lookups can lag new jurisdiction data by up to that window. This is expected behavior, not a bug. If a merchant reports an incorrect rate inside that window, a manual cache flush resolves it immediately. Flushes are safe during business hours and take under a minute. The flush procedure and cache topology are documented internally here.

operations page: https://jira.lumicsys.internal/browse/browse/display/projects